The draw for the 2018-19 William Hill Scottish Cup Fifth Round took place at Tynecastle Park this evening.

Host Jane Lewis was joined by former Scotland international Craig Beattie, who won the Scottish Cup with both Celtic and Hearts, and Rebecca Sellar, Scotland international amputee footballer and star of the latest in the Scottish FA’s Football Saved My Life video series.

The ties will be played on between 9-11 February 2019.

The draw for the William Hill Scottish Cup Fifth Round is as follows (all kick-offs 3pm except when stated):

Saturday 9 February

Hibernian v Raith Rovers

St Mirren v Dundee United

East Fife v Partick Thistle

Kilmarnock v Rangers (kick-off 5.15pm, live on Premier Sports)

Sunday 10 February

Celtic v St Johnstone (kick-off 1.30pm, live on Premier Sports)

Heart of Midlothian v Auchinleck Talbot

Aberdeen v Queen of the South (kick-off 3.30pm, live on BBC Scotland)

Monday 11 February

Ross County v Inverness Caledonian Thistle (kick-off 7.15pm, live on BBC Scotland)
